<h3>What is phagocytosis?</h3>

Phagocytosis is the form of endocytosis in which a cell incorporates a particle by drawing the particle into a vacuole of its cytoplasm.

The white blood cell, also known as the leucocytes are the defense of the body as they help fight against foreign substances which they attack by phagocytosis.

What does the sour taste come from in foods such as cheese and yogurt?
STatiana [176]
Lactic acid produced by fermentation causes the sour taste.
